Quick question. I have read somewhere here before that you should NOT attach the deck to the home as you would with typical site built homes.

Why?

tom , it is because of load support. the home is designed to carry x amount of weight when it is asked to support a porch it is adding addl weight. that may cause problems later. most site built have a peimeter wall supporting edge of home where on a pier system you do not. you can build the deck and have it be self supporting , you could add just a couple of screwws for stability but build it free standing, also anywhere you put a nail in is a potential way for water to get in . as a plus if you ever want to move the deck , it wont damage home moving it out of way. for deck with roof you atach it so the shingles are seamless , just design it is free standing and supports it s on weight, basically on eof the hud code requirements
